A video of a smoke-shrouded Suji in the Kursk region, which is being attacked by the Russian army, has appeared on the Web.
The city is occupied by the Ukrainian Armed Forces. According to reports, about 2 thousand Ukrainian servicemen are currently locked up there.
The footage was published by the Ukrainian edition of Strana in its telegram channel.
"The city is shrouded in smoke," the newspaper notes.
As reported by EADaily, the Russian army reached the administrative borders of Sudzhi and began storming the city, there are battles going on in it, there are about 2 thousand soldiers of the Armed Forces of Ukraine in the settlement, many of whom are seriously wounded. This was reported by the telegram channel Mash.
